The Fundamentals of Effective Communication
To succeed in communication, one must first understand the basics. Effective communication entails the clear and concise exchange of ideas and opinions between people. Here are some key factors:
Active Listening: Being a good communicator starts with active listening. This involves giving focus to what the other person is communicating, comprehending their views, and replying appropriately.

Conquering Communication Barriers
Interaction obstacles can be an ongoing issue in accomplishing effective dialogues:
Cultural Differences: Cultural backgrounds can affect communication styles. Being mindful of these distinctions can aid in closing gaps.
Language Barriers: When communicating in a second language, it's easy to misconstrue messages. Simple language and avoiding technical terms can assist.
Strategies for Improving Communication Skills
An individual can hone their communication skills with practice and commitment:
Feedback: Requesting feedback can provide useful insights into ways you can enhance your communication.
